    Hey, can anyone give me a tl;dr about which weapons are just direct upgrades from differing ones in rifles/pistols/snipers/shotguns? If it matters, I'm running a SP Soldier on Hardcore, and I don't know if MP weapon damage values have been adjusted for balance...

    Like, the Scimitar is pretty much superior to the Katana, right? The Eviscerator and Claymore do different things, but at least for the Katana-Scimitar comparison, one of these is a winner?

    There's a ton of weapons in ME3, at least compared to ME2.

    Some days Blue wonders why anyone ever bothered making numbers so small; other days she supposes even infinity needs to start somewhere.
  • Options
    OrcaOrca Also known as Espressosaurus WrexRegistered User regular
    edited March 2013
    The Katana and Scimitar are more sidegrades. The Scimitar does less damage per pull of the trigger, but it shoots much more rapidly.

    Both are rather mediocre weapons, and the Scimitar downright sucks against armor.

    edit: for shotguns, the Eviscerator is decent, but eclipsed by the Reegar, Graal, Wraith (especially the Wraith), Geth Plasma Shotgun, Claymore, Piranha, Venom and Crusader.

    edit2: the Reegar is a war crime in the guise of a shotgun. The Venom a grenade pattern launcher. So: what's your style?

    You notice it when you're playing on Gold and playing either an extremely squishy class (Drell, non-Jugg Geth), or one that does its business up close and personal (Novaguard, Fury, Valkyrie).

    Off-host you'll die loads more, both because you notice you're getting shot sooner, and because you're able to react to getting shot sooner (and possibly react before getting shot in the first place).

    No. On xbox. And really, I would say when you get in a room with a decent connection the netcode is okay(and all and all I rarely have shitty games just games where I noticed lag behavior).

    I would say the biggest issues that happen with lag is the sound cutting out(this happens a lot), me getting shot and it taking a moment to register, then me dying shortly after.

    This is something that I would say I notice the most when hosting.

    When I'm host, I can dodge burst fire from Centurions/Marauders mid-burst, when I'm not hosting its pretty much a fifty-fifty.

    Like have you ever noticed the times when you dodge a shot, die anyway then rubberband back to the spot you just dodged away from. That's lag.

    And I would say that while there will probably always be lag, if we could see the connection of our host beforehand that would go a long way to making it more bearable for everyone.

    Also, try playing one of the non-Kroguard vanguard classes host/off-host. Its like night and day.
